Vacuum Decay Time in Strong External Fields
arXiv:0808.0874 · doi:10.1103/PhysRevD.79.057901
Abstract
We consider dynamics of vacuum decay and particle production in the context of short pulse laser experiments. We identify and evaluate the invariant "materialization time," $Ï$, the timescale for the conversion of an electromagnetic field energy into particles, and we compare to the laser related time scales.
